My, how time flies! This Saturday, October 13, 2012 is the 2nd anniversary of the delivery of my most famous message in 40 years of ministry - a message entitled 'A Real Message to Real People'. That message changed a lot of things in my life and in Church In The Now, to say the least...I won't go over all the events that have transpired since that Wednesday night, but I will say, to the glory of God, that two years later I am still in full-time ministry, both as a Pastor of two congregations, CHURCH IN THE NOW EAST (Covington) and CHURCH IN THE NOW MIDTOWN (Atlanta)...actually, three congregations if you count CHURCH IN THE NOW ONLINE (Global), and as a Bishop (NOW MINISTRIES), and am happier and more excited about the Kingdom of God than I have ever been...and still, two full years later, hardly a day goes by without my receiving a note or letter from someone somewhere in the world about that message. Here's what I wrote about it in my new book, FIRST, THE GOOD NEWS: The Positive Truth About God, The Gospel, and What it Really Means to be Gay:
Anyway, to fast-forward the story and get to the incentive for writing this book, I finally "came out" to the whole world on Wednesday, October 13, 2010...The tape of the service went viral on the internet almost immediately after I delivered the message, became for a few days the video with the most hits on YouTube, and garnered an unbelievable amount of unexpected media exposure in the following weeks and months. The response to it was, for me, astounding. On that Wednesday night I had no plan or outline of what I wanted to say...no script or pre-meditation of it at all. Had I known beforehand that the video was going to become so high profile, I would have no doubt phrased a few things that I said that night differently, but it was what it was. But there was not one day in the following year that I didn't hear from someone somewhere in the world who wanted to thank me for it, or to tell me that it changed their perception of God or of religion or of people with same sex attraction. Atheists told me that it made them want to believe in God again. Straight people told me that it helped them come to terms with their gay friends and family members, or even with their own authenticity issues. Some gay teens told me it kept them from considering suicide, and many of their parents told me that it opened up broken lines of communication, and brought much-needed healing to their families. So even though the letter of the message wasn't perfect, the spirit of it apparently came through loud and clear, and for that I am very grateful.You can find some reviews of the book in the previous post here on BLOGINTHENOW II...and thank you, by the way, for all of your wonderful comments!

That's A Good Question!
"Never doubt that a small group of thoughtful, committed citizens can change the world; indeed, it's the only thing that ever has."
- Margaret Mead
I was standing in line for a ride at Six Flags Over Georgia the other day (I know, I know...I can't believe it, either...never say never)...anyway, I was wearing my CHURCH IN THE NOW T-shirt, and a man in line in front of me, who apparently didn't recognize me behind my sunglasses and in that setting, looked at my shirt and asked, "Whatever happened to that church?"Wow...that's a loaded question...
He went on to say that he used to watch "that guy" on TV and thought he was pretty good, but he had seen that they weren't on I-20 any more, so he just assumed they had shut down.
I assured him that we were still very much alive and well, and about to move into a permanent location...and because I didn't want to embarrass him (and because I just wanted to ride the ride), that was the end of our exchange...
But it is an interesting thing to ponder...
Just what did happen to that church?
Well...since leaving our previous place of worship the middle of April we (CHURCH IN THE NOW EAST) have met in a theatre...
